Output 776e526d95c08d5890d07ea7445167bf26e1389513470b30126f859d34a1a229:0

value
66300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18fea49a07335a35266dcebad4635e2975390bfa OP_EQUALVERIFY OP_CHECKSIG
address
13HAGWU1nFihkYPLXoSrDPiG4vuwUj6LuE
transaction
776e526d95c08d5890d07ea7445167bf26e1389513470b30126f859d34a1a229
spent
true